Product Manager, Accounting About FreshBooksFreshBooks is a leading cloud-based SaaS accounting software designed with one goal: to help small business owners grow. We reached unicorn status after raising our valuation to more than $1 billion and continue to scale our business to serve business owners, their clients, and accountants in more than 160 countries worldwide. FreshBookers are found all over the globe, and we know that different folks thrive in different working environments: Remote, onsite, and everything in between, you ll find it with us. The Opportunity - Product Manager, AccountingFreshBooks is looking for a Product Manager to help reshape the world to meet the needs of our customers: small business owners and entrepreneurs. In this role, you will be focused on our Accounting, Payroll and workflow offerings that will enable scaling users to seamlessly manage their books and plan for the future within FreshBooks. You ll develop such a deep understanding of user needs, and will help create experiences that are unique to their stage, vertical, and segment.What Youll Do as a Product ManagerBe a leader and influencer throughout the organization, coll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ure understanding of desired outcomes and how it aligns with product vision/missionLead ongoing workstream product planning; be the product expert when it comes to your accounting domain area and workflow managementOrganize and manage an agile team of developers, designers, and product marketing managers to execute and deliver desired outcomes for our clients;Be responsible for your results and report out the impact your product contributions are makingAdvocate for our customers and the products, spend time with customers to develop a deep empathy for the challenges of small businessesWhat Youll Bring to the RoleProven product management work experience or strong understanding of bookkeeping, payroll and accounting standards in your previous roles; demonstrated ability to understand impact of transactions in financial report a plus;Technically savvy and comfortable working with a team of developers and a UX designer to understand the challenges and trade offs that come with building great products.Youre a passionate leader and an excellent communicator. You are responsible for your results and can report out to partners and execs on the adoption, engagement, and key metrics of products launched in-marketYou are data driven; you can understand the unit economics of our business, know which one you re trying to impact, and how to know if you re successfulYou have the ability to think big picture and develop a compelling vision for your product or featureEmpathy is your strong suit - you can spend time with external and internal customers to develop a deep understanding of the challenges of small businesses; and be able to document, analyze, and synthesize their needs into a compelling product visionDemonstrated ability to quickly learn, adapt, and apply knowledge in a rapidly changing landscapeYoull Stand Out If You Bring Experience InWorking knowledge of an accounting and/or payroll platform - either as a business owner or an accountantYou re not a project manager, but you re not afraid to act like one be willing to roll up your sleeves to help your team get things doneA history of bringing major features to market fast, and iterating based on customer feedback (familiarity with lean methodologies a plus) Our Commitments to YouAt FreshBooks each person knows their opinion is valued, and can see their impact on the lives of over 10 million small business owners around the world.
